Pennsylvania Justice – Understanding the Courts, is a fast-paced, animated video that describes the role and work of the courts.
Developed and produced by the Administrative Office of Pennsylvania Courts, the four-minute video is aimed at a broad audience including high-school students, potential jurors or anyone looking for a greater understanding of the Pennsylvania judiciary.
The video details the role of the courts in a democracy, the structure of the Pennsylvania court system including jury service and how various types of cases advance through the system.
Using animated graphics and case examples, the video highlights each level of Pennsylvania’s court system including:
- Supreme Court
- Superior Court
- Commonwealth Court
- Court of Common Pleas
- Magisterial District Courts and Philadelphia Municipal Court
The video simplifies the seemingly intricate organization of Pennsylvania’s judiciary and its appeals process.
